Fort Branch is a town located in Gibson County, Indiana. Fort Branch has a 2026 population of 2,918. Fort Branch is currently declining at a rate of -0.27% annually and its population has decreased by -1.72% since the most recent census, which recorded a population of 2,969 in 2020.
The median household income in Fort Branch is $58,707 with a poverty rate of 17.18%. The median age in Fort Branch is 35.1 years: 34.5 years for males, and 39.1 years for females. For every 100 females there are 110.5 males.

The racial composition of Fort Branch includes 85.2% White, 3.61% other race, and smaller percentages for Native American and multiracial populations.
| Race | Population ↓ | Percentage (of total) |
|---|---|---|
| White | 2,574 | 85.2% |
| Two or more races | 335 | 11.09% |
| Other race | 109 | 3.61% |
| Native American | 3 | 0.1% |
Fort Branch 's average per capita income is $49,638. Household income levels show a median of $58,707. The poverty rate stands at 17.18%.
| Name | Median ↓ | Mean |
|---|---|---|
| Married Families | $96,250 | - |
| Families | $59,483 | $77,228 |
| Households | $58,707 | $72,082 |
| Non Families | $49,412 | $61,719 |
